Analysis of temperature and stress field in Al alloy's twin wire welding
چکیده انگلیسی
By analyzing the shape of twin wire welding's arcs and the track of droplets' transition, the phenomenon that the twin wire welding's fore arc and rear arc all deflect to the middle of the two arcs is found. Based on this the double ellipsoid heat source model is amended, and a heat source model which can apply to calculate the twin wire welding's temperature field is put forward. This model is testified by actual experiment of temperature sampling. By comparing the temperature field of twin wire welding and single wire welding, the results show that twin wire welding has slender weld pool the end part of which is ellipsoid, and its HAZ is narrower than that of single wire welding. So, twin wire welding can not only reduce the Al alloy generating hot crack, but can also weaken the “overaging” softened phenomenon of heat treated strengthening Al alloy. In the end, the evolving rules of 2219 Al alloy's longitudinal and transverse stress when welded with twin wire welding are analyzed.
